1993 Citroen Xantia vs. 1993 Toyota Corolla

To start off, both 1993 Citroen Xantia and 1993 Toyota Corolla were released in the same year (1993).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 1,975 cc (4 cylinders), 1993 Toyota Corolla is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1993 Citroen Xantia (108 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 37 more horse power than 1993 Toyota Corolla. (71 HP @ 4600 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1993 Citroen Xantia should accelerate faster than 1993 Toyota Corolla.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1993 Citroen Xantia weights approximately 159 kg more than 1993 Toyota Corolla.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1993 Citroen Xantia (155 Nm @ 4250 RPM) has 23 more torque (in Nm) than 1993 Toyota Corolla. (132 Nm @ 2500 RPM). This means 1993 Citroen Xantia will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1993 Toyota Corolla.

Compare all specifications:

1993 Citroen Xantia 1993 Toyota Corolla
Make Citroen Toyota
Model Xantia Corolla
Year Released 1993 1993
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1749 cc 1975 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 108 HP 71 HP
Engine RPM 5500 RPM 4600 RPM
Torque 155 Nm 132 Nm
Torque RPM 4250 RPM 2500 RPM
Engine Bore Size 83.1 mm 86 mm
Engine Stroke Size 81.4 mm 85 mm
Drive Type Front Front
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 3 doors
Vehicle Weight 1234 kg 1075 kg
Vehicle Length 4450 mm 4120 mm
Vehicle Width 1760 mm 1700 mm
Vehicle Height 1390 mm 1390 mm
Wheelbase Size 2860 mm 2470 mm
